Unit 2: Biblical Christianity – the true view of god and the world Lesson 3: God’s Great Story

Lesson 3: God’s Great Story

Lesson 3: God’s Great Story 1. Musical staff and notes in harmony 2. Faces and hands turned toward God 3. Happy faces, white robes of purity 4. Man and woman holding hands 5. Fruitfulness of the earth; lion & lamb 6. Uneaten fruit in lower left corner

Lesson 3: God’s Great Story half-eaten fruit in lower left corner Broken notes in disharmony People’s backs turned toward God’s eyes People’s faces & postures show despair Glaring faces; poverty vs. wealth Dry earth; lion & lamb in conflict

Lesson 3: God’s Great Story The cross Hands and faces lifted upward Joy in people’s faces Groups of people in fellowship Fruit, greenness of nature
